And things look deadlier than ever in the newly-released Scream 6 teaser trailer, which is set to be a sequel to Scream 5, which was released in early 2022. Since then, we have been waiting patiently for any glimpse of the upcoming sixth instalment of the hit slasher series, directed by Matt Bettinelli-Olpin and Tyler Gillett, and we finally have it! Eek!
In the teaser trailer, which is just over a minute long, the crazed masked killer follows the four survivors of the fifth movie, played by Wednesday star Jenna Ortega, Melissa Barrera, Mason Gooding and Jasmin Savoy Brown from Woodsboro to the bright lights of New York. The terrified pals are quickly trapped in a sea of costumed New York subway riders before the lights go out. Of course. When the lights flicker back on, Ghostface is up close and personal to unleash his terror! The Twitter account for the movie franchise Scream captioned the trailer: “In a city of millions, no one hears you scream. Watch the official Teaser Trailer for #Scream6 – Only in theatres March 10, 2023.” We have a release date, as well!

Who is part of the cast?
As well as Jenna, Melissa, Mason and Jasmin, other members of the Scream franchise will return, including Hayden Panettiere as Kirby Reed and Courteney Cox as Gale Weathers.
